Censorship and Internet Shutdowns During the January 2026 Protests

Global Implications of Iran’s Digital Repression

Sets a Precedent for Authoritarian Control

Iran’s extensive use of censorship and shutdowns signals a broader trend among authoritarian regimes to control digital spaces as a means to suppress dissent. Other nations can observe and emulate these tactics, leading to a global erosion of internet freedoms.

Challenges for Global Technology Providers

Tech companies face increasing dilemmas:

  • Balancing Business and Human Rights: Should they comply with local laws that restrict rights or oppose censorship to uphold global standards?
  • Developing Countermeasures: Innovate tools that enable users to circumvent censorship without risking their safety.

Impact on International Human Rights Norms

The Iran case underscores the need to strengthen international norms and treaties that affirm digital rights, including the right to access information and freedom of expression online.
